Summary

Coforma is seeking a detail-oriented Design Researcher for a US-based remote position. The Design Researcher will collaborate with government agencies, nonprofits, and cause-based organizations to help improve digital services. The role requires 5+ years of professional work experience in research or human-centered design research, at least 3 years of consulting or client-facing professional services practice, and professional or volunteer experience working with marginalized or underserved communities.

Requirements

  • 5+ years of professional work experience with research and/or human-centered design research
  • At least 3 years of consulting or client-facing professional services practice
  • Professional or volunteer experience working with marginalized or underserved communities

Responsibilities

  • Conduct, analyze, and present primary and secondary research to inform the larger team’s work
  • Plan and facilitate primary research sessions (in-depth interviews, UX sessions, etc.) based on the team’s questions and goals
  • Plan and facilitate outreach and recruitment activities to engage research participants
  • Manage professional communications with a diverse group of stakeholders
  • Conduct rapid desk research (secondary), triangulating from a range of sources such as academic literature, conference publications, nonprofit and government reports, etc
  • Creatively utilize qualitative research methods such as in-depth interviews, ethnographic field research, focus groups, UX sessions, and others with a focus on humility, understanding, and compassion
  • Collaboratively synthesize research findings with a focus on bringing the voices of those we serve into the actionable recommendations and guidance we provide to our cross-functional colleagues
  • Articulate recommendations and opportunities for diverse stakeholder audiences
  • Advocate from a human-centered perspective throughout design and implementation phases of our work
  • Help create inclusive partnerships to increase the participatory capacity of projects and/or programs to be designed by and with involved individuals and communities
  • Seek out opportunities to both mentor and receive guidance from your peers, with a focus on growing a shared understanding of ethical and trauma-informed research and participatory design practices
  • Model and promote a highly collaborative, responsible, and ethical culture through your individual actions and interactions
